How do you get from Geneva to Alpe d Huez?
There is no direct connection from Geneva to Alpe d'Huez. However, you can take the train to Grenoble Universites Gieres then take the taxi to Alpe d'Huez.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Geneva to Alpe d'Huez via Grenoble, Gares, and Agence Transisere Vfd in around 4h 53m.
What is the nearest airport to Alpe d Huez?
Grenoble Airport is the closest airport to Alpe d'Huez, followed by Chambery and then Lyon Airport. Of course the transfer time depends on the traffic and weather but the journey usually takes about 1 hour 45 minutes from Grenoble Airport.

How do I get from Lyon Airport to Alpe d Huez?
The standard route from Lyon airport to Alpe d'Huez (152km) will usually take you via route A48. Continue to your destination (Saint-Laurent-de-Mure). Take the A43, A48 and A480 in the direction of the Route Napoléon/N85 (Vizille). Take the D1091 in the direction of D211 (Huez).

What is the fastest time up Alpe d Huez?
The fastest recorded time up Alpe d'Huez was set by Marco Pantani in 1997 (in a very different era) with a time of 37'35” (although some reports say that Pantani broke 36 minutes twice).
How long is Alpe du Zwift?
How long is Alpe du Zwift? Just like the Alpe d'Huez from the Tour de France, this route is 12.24 km (7.6 miles) long, with a total elevation gain of over 1000 meters (3400′)!
What route is Alpe du Zwift?
Road to Sky is the quickest route to Alpe du Zwift, the longest climb on Watopia. A GPS-accurate re-creation of the legendary Alpe D'Huez (one of the more famous Tour de France stages), Alpe du Zwift takes some riders 2+ hours to complete, while top pros complete it in under 40 minutes!
Where is the tunnel ski run?
Le Tunnel, Alpe d'Huez
Any fall that's not immediately arrested can result in a slide of 200m – or worse. The tunnel itself is a 60m horizontal passage through the rock. The full horror is revealed when you emerge on the far side. The slope falls away to your left at what appears to be a wicked angle.
